Output 95506e12624635063ec076d27374e345e9aa9c8b22e1199c48ae172c964e3f39:1

value
5451840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23a8716d49d65c5cc481f097438e5ce89a63333c OP_EQUAL
address
34wZMtShyMP8Drpap3uibF2T4UYRja7k7Q
transaction
95506e12624635063ec076d27374e345e9aa9c8b22e1199c48ae172c964e3f39
spent
true